Output 890356027381d0a6611dabe2eafd26f1f38808bf424357ece4961e074fad62d0:101

value
57767
script pubkey
OP_0 OP_PUSHBYTES_32 e18730bfd20ba90e296d98a708ef3ec07ae5bf1d89494c49771b7880f4d83a8d
address
bc1quxrnp07jpw5su2tdnzns3me7cpawt0ca39y5cjthrdugpaxc82xscp7p8z
transaction
890356027381d0a6611dabe2eafd26f1f38808bf424357ece4961e074fad62d0